Transaction 7563113d1ba7816c59a338441cbb7a972f1e5db4ed5594434e9f9c0e167e94f4
1 Input
1 Output
-
7563113d1ba7816c59a338441cbb7a972f1e5db4ed5594434e9f9c0e167e94f4:0
- value
- 357582
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8b1a37b934c0efe6ae7ee415af3b4cf780fe76d
- address
- bc1qmzc6x7unfs80u6h8aeq44ua5eauqlemd3akgey